Cupertino homes were built in the 1950s through the early 1970s — what does that mean for their drains?

Homes of that era typically have clay or cast-iron laterals — plastic pipe only took over in the 1970s. Clay and cast iron develop root intrusion and bellies with age, so recurring clogs justify a camera inspection rather than repeat cabling.

Are tree roots a real problem for Cupertino sewer lines?

Yes — the mature canopy over Cupertino's older neighborhoods sends roots into every joint of aging clay laterals. If a main-line clog comes back within months, a camera inspection will almost always show root intrusion; jetting plus scheduled maintenance usually controls it, severe cases need lining or replacement.

Can hydro jetting damage pipes?

On sound pipe, no — pressure is adjusted to the material. On badly cracked or collapsing pipe it can finish the job, which is why a camera inspection first is standard good practice.
